Joseph PASK was born on 16 February 1827 in Willingham, Lincolnshire.1,2 He was the son of William PASK and Mary PASK née ?1,2 In the census of 7 June 1841 in Kexby, Lincolnshire, he was listed as aged 14, assumed to be the son of William PASK.1 In the census of 30 March 1851 in Kexby, Lincolnshire, he was listed as a Miller aged 23 born in Willingham, the son of William PASK.3
Joseph married Hannah ROBINSON in 1853 in the Gainsborough registration district.4,5,6 In the census of 7 April 1861 he was at the same address as his father William PASK, but enumerated as a different household.7
In the census of 7 April 1861 in Kexby Street, Kexby, Lincolnshire, Joseph was listed as aged 32 born in Willingham, the Head of Household; an Agricultural Labourer, living with his wife Hannah, and children Charles, and Elizabeth.7
Joseph was detailed in the minutes taken from Gainsborough Workhouse "23 April 1867 PASK Joseph, Kexby given out relief.8 Joseph was detailed in the Gainsborough Workhouse Minutes "19 November 1867. The clerk read a letter from the Poor Law Board forwarding a copy of a letter from the Rev. E. Hawke complaining of the conduct of Mr Johnson, the guardian for Kexby and Surveyor of the Highways with reference to two men Pask & Dowman who had been turned off the roads in that parish on account of the relief previously given by the Board having been discontinued. [Page 397]"9 Joseph was detailed in the minutes taken from Gainsborough Workhouse "25 January 1868 Out relief given to PASK Joseph, Kexby."8
In the census of 2 April 1871 in Gainsborough Road, Kexby, Lincolnshire, Joseph was listed as aged 42 born in Kexby, the Head of Household; an Agricultural Labourer living with his wife Hannah, and children Charles, Judith, Mary, and Henry.4
Joseph's death was registered in 1871 in the Gainsborough registration district.10 Joseph was buried on 2 July 1871 in All Saints, Upton cum Kexby, Lincolnshire, at the age of 44.11
